Furthermore, online gaming has become a significant industry in its own right. Esports, or competitive gaming, has turned into a multi-billion dollar industry, with professional players, teams, and leagues emerging in various game titles. Events like The International for Dota 2, the League of Legends World Championship, and the Fortnite World Cup have garnered millions of viewers globally, further solidifying gaming as a legitimate form of entertainment and competition. Esports is even beginning to be recognized by institutions, with universities offering scholarships for gamers and some games even being considered for inclusion in the Olympics.
However, while online gaming has many positive aspects, it also comes with its challenges. One major issue is the potential for addiction, as some players spend countless hours in front of screens. Parents and guardians may struggle with balancing their children’s screen time, and in some cases, the immersion in gaming can take a toll on social relationships and physical health. Additionally, the rise of toxic behavior and harassment in online communities remains a concern. Game developers and platform providers are working to implement better moderation systems, but addressing these issues requires continued effort from the entire gaming community.
